InterServer VPS pricing — 2026

InterServer uses a simple, transparent "slice" model: every step up adds more vCPU, RAM, and SSD storage at a flat, predictable price. Start small and scale up only when you need to — no surprise tiers.

vCPURAMSSD storagePrice / month
1 core2 GB40 GB$3
2 cores6 GB120 GB$9
3 cores10 GB200 GB$15
4 cores14 GB280 GB$21
5 cores18 GB360 GB$27
6 cores22 GB440 GB$33
7 cores26 GB520 GB$39
8 cores30 GB600 GB$45
… scales all the way up …
16 cores64 GB1280 GB$96

Every plan ships with a free IPv4, a 10 Gbps shared port, and no setup fee. See the full configurator on InterServer and remember to enter WORLDIP at checkout.

Who is a $3 VPS good for?

  • Developers who need a cheap, disposable staging or test box with root access.
  • Self-hosters running a VPN, Pi-hole, game server, Discord bot, or personal cloud.
  • Small sites and side projects that have outgrown shared hosting but don't need a dedicated server.
  • Tinkerers who want custom-ISO freedom to experiment with new operating systems.
